As others have said this stretch is now supposed to be set at permanent 50mph to reduce pollution… 1 of 3 places in Wales.
I travel it normally X2 a day minimum and its nearly always as described by bald bloke.

Eastbound coming through tunnels set at 50, up the hill goes back to national speed limit then just as you drop down to jnc 24 a combination of 40 or 50 showing.
